Getting a natural, relaxed image in posed pictures of friends and family is art, not science. It takes a number of ingredients, particularly mastering the science portion of photography so you, the photographer, can be natural and relaxed. This photo safari, taught by professional portrait photographer Bob Blanken, will use the wonderful settings available at Brookside Gardens in Wheaton MD for an instructional beginner-level workshop that will have you:
Bob Blanken is past president of The Professional Photographers Society of Greater Washington and the Maryland Professional Photographers Association. His photographs and albums have won numerous awards. He is VP of Education for the Greater Washington, DC Chapter of International Special Events Society.
